Tranent Juniors Football Club are a Scottish football club based in the town of Tranent, East Lothian. The team plays in the East of Scotland Football League Premier Division having moved from the junior leagues in 2018. Despite leaving the junior leagues, the club has retained the term "Juniors" as part of their identity. Their home ground is Foresters Park and club colours are maroon.

The club's greatest honour was winning the Scottish Junior Cup in 1934–35, defeating Petershill 6–1 at Ibrox Park in front of a crowd of 22,000. This remains the joint record margin of victory in a Junior Cup final. The club were also runners-up to Yoker Athletic in the 1932–33 final after a replay.

East Lothian Council Archives holds a selection of images of the team playing and posing with their trophies.
